释义 | immediately/ɪˈmiːdɪətli![]() adverb 1At once; instantly: I rang immediately for an ambulance...
Synonyms straight away, at once, right away, right now, instantly, now, directly, promptly, forthwith, this/that (very) minute, this/that instant, there and then, here and now, in a flash, without delay, without hesitation, without further ado, post-haste; quickly, as fast as possible, fast, speedily, with all speed, as soon as possible, a.s.a.p.; French tout de suite informal before you can say Jack Robinson, pronto, double quick, in double quick time, p.d.q. (pretty damn quick), toot sweet Indian informal ekdam archaic straightway, instanter, forthright 2Without any intervening time or space: she was sitting immediately behind me...
2.1In direct or very close relation: they would be the states most immediately affected by any such action...
Synonyms directly, right, exactly, precisely, squarely, just, dead; close, closely, at close quarters informal slap bang North American informal smack dab conjunction chiefly British As soon as: let me know immediately she arrives |
